宫颈锥形切除术后宫颈组织中TNF-α、IL-6、HMGB1的表达及其意义研究
The expression and significance of TNF-α,IL-6, HMGB1 in the cervix uteri after the prior cervical conization
摘要
Abstract
Objective To investigate the dynamic changes and its significance of inflammatory factors in cervical secretions and prior cervical tissues after cervical conical resection.Methods Women who received prior cervical conization during December 2013 and December 2015 in this hospital were selected,then the cervical tissue and secretion were collected regular interval after the conization.The expression of tumor necrosis factor-α(TNF),interleukin 6 (IL-6) and high mobility group protein 1 (HMGB1) were quantitative detected and analyzed.The expression and infiltration of inflammatory cell were detected by HE and immunohistochemical staining.Results The expression of TNF-α,IL-6 and HMGB1 in cervical tissues and secretions increased gradually after priorcervical conization,which reached the peak at 1 to 2 weeks after priorcervical conization,and then gradually decreased,the differences were statistically significant when compared with the preoperative control group (P<0.05).The inflammatory cell infiltration and the inflammatory response were most severe at 1st week after the conization.The expression of TNF-α,IL 6 and HMGB1 was at 1st week after the conization were significantly higher than that of the 4thweek group.Conclusion The cervical inflammatory were most severe after the prior cervical conization about 1-2weeks,and the hysterectomy should be avoided at this stage.关键词
